Descripción:In a contemporary world that seems to fight more for equality and respect for diversity, we can lose sight of the fact that the achieved achievements have a deep history framed by segregation, rejection and accusations, which can deviate us from the what is really important therefore. This article seeks to reflect on the historical and social development of the struggle and activism of the LGBTI+ community in Mexico, encompassing its strongly religious past, and the great influence thatinternational society has had on the achievement of greater rights for the Mexican population. In conclusion, we see the need to focus on a struggle that continues to be active and that, despite the goals achieved, has still pending objectives.
